Output 68d63e52594cb84cd51c17452a709cf05783de0f9d8ae679a13a0a0f2c2fc287:0

value
1159845
script pubkey
OP_0 OP_PUSHBYTES_20 8ac8355cd774abdd1991a9d4ba8fcf36768a51eb
address
bc1q3tyr2hxhwj4a6xv3482t4r70xemg550tlmu3cx
transaction
68d63e52594cb84cd51c17452a709cf05783de0f9d8ae679a13a0a0f2c2fc287
confirmations
93863
spent
true